Compass Connections believes every child deserves to have a place where they feel safe and loved. Our organization offers emergency shelter and group home placement for children while we work to reunite them with family.
We know the sooner family reunification is accomplished, the sooner children can safely integrate into the community and thrive.

- Meet all federal and state regulatory guidelines and standards that are applicable to this position.
- Document all serious incidents, daily progress, and activities completely, accurately and in a timely manner and in compliance with agency policies and procedures.
- Assist with orientation of new children and staff.
- Provide input into development of treatment plans as appropriate or requested.
- Use positive child management techniques including verbal redirection, de-escalation, and containment.
- Plan, organize and supervise activities for children in accordance with the daily activity schedule.
- Teach constructive behavior and social skills, realistic problem-solving behaviors, responsible time and money management, conversational English, personal hygiene, and life skills.
- Assist children with homework assignments.
- Maintain an orderly and clean children’s living area including assisting in the household and children’s laundry, overseeing daily chores, identifying routine maintenance work/repair, and reporting it to the Unit Manager.
- Maintain and update records regarding children’s clothing and personal items.
- Maintain a secure campus environment by making rounds as required, and by using proper application of radio communication protocols including responding to all radio calls.
- Take actions to promote positive interaction between children and encourage children to take responsibility in the daily routine of the facility.
- Model culturally and socially desired behaviors while explaining the behaviors to children to facilitate learning and replication of the behaviors.
- Work evenings, weekends and holidays as needed or requested by position supervisor.
- Implement Compass Connections safety protocols including evacuating with children and other staff in case of an emergency.
- Maintain confidentiality in all areas of child and program operations.
- Maintain Compass Connections professional and ethical standards of conduct outlined in Compass Connections employee handbook including demonstrating respect for agency staff, children, and community members and complying with required dress code at all times.
